Physical Therapist Assistants Salary

in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ont, CA

The median pay for a physical therapist assistants in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ont, CA is $95,920/year ($46.12/hour), per BLS data. The range runs from $67K at the entry level to $117K for experienced workers. Prices run high here (RPP 115.61), so that salary is closer to $82,969 in real purchasing power. A 2-bedroom apartment runs $3,604/month, about 59.8% of take-home, which is tight.

What this looks like in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ont

San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ont sits well above the national pay line for physical therapist assistants, local pay runs about 40% higher than the U.S. median of $68K. The catch: housing math doesn't keep up. A 2-bedroom at the HUD median rents for $3,604/month, which is 61.1% of the median worker's take-home, past the 30% guideline most planners use. Cost-of-living overall is 16% above the national average (BEA RPP 115.61), so groceries and services cost more too. The pay premium is real, but so are the offsets.

Frequently asked questions

Can a physical therapist assistant afford a 2BR apartment alone in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ont?

It’s a stretch — at the median salary of $96K, rent takes 61.1% of take-home pay. A 2-bedroom at the HUD Fair Market Rent runs $3,604/month. The 30% guideline puts the comfortable ceiling at roughly $1,800/month in rent — so roommates or a 1-bedroom would ease the math significantly.

What’s the entry-level salary for physical therapist assistants in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ont?

The 10th-percentile wage — what new physical therapist assistants typically earn — is $67K/year. Take-home on that works out to about $3,996/month. At HUD’s $3,604/month FMR, rent would take 90% of that take-home — above the 30% guideline, so a 1-bedroom or shared housing is likely necessary starting out.

Is physical therapist assistant a high-paying job in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ont?

Local pay is 40% above the national median — $96K here vs. $68K nationally. Keep in mind cost of living here is 16% above the national average, which offsets some of that premium.

How does San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ont compare to the national average for physical therapist assistants?

San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ont pays $96K median vs. the U.S. average of $68K — that’s +40%. After adjusting for local cost of living (RPP 115.61), the purchasing-power equivalent is $83K — still ahead of the national median.

How much do physical therapist assistants make in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ont, CA?

The median is $95,920 a year, that works out to about $46 an hour. But the range is wide: entry-level workers start around $66,600, and experienced physical therapist assistants can clear $116,850. These are BLS numbers, based on employer-reported data, not self-reported surveys.

Is $96K enough to live in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ont?

On that salary, you'd take home roughly $5,901/month after taxes. A 2-bedroom here rents for about $3,604/month, which eats 61.1% of your paycheck. That's above the 30% rule of thumb, housing will be a stretch at the median salary, though you can manage with roommates or a smaller place.

How far does a physical therapist assistants salary go in San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ont?

San Francisco-Oakland-Fremont has a Regional Price Parity of 115.61 (100 is the national average). Prices are above average here, so your dollar buys less than the same salary would in a cheaper metro. After cost-of-living adjustment, the median physical therapist assistants salary is worth about $82,969 in national-average purchasing power.
